19.15 Cautions
(1) When IICFn.STCENn bit = 0
Immediately after the I
2
C0n operation is enabled, the bus communication status (IICFn.IICBSYn bit = 1) is
recognized regardless of the actual bus status. To execute master communication in the status where a stop
condition has not been detected, generate a stop condition and then release the bus before starting the master
communication.
Use the following sequence for generating a stop condition.
<1> Set the IICCLn register.
<2> Set the IICCn.IICEn bit.
<3> Set the IICCn.SPTn bit.
(2) When IICFn.STCENn bit = 1
Immediately after I
2
C0n operation is enabled, the bus release status (IICBSYn bit = 0) is recognized regardless of
the actual bus status. To generate the first start condition (IICCn.STTn bit = 1), it is necessary to confirm that the
bus has been released, so as to not disturb other communications.
(3) When the IICCn.IICEn bit of the V850ES/JG3-H and V850ES/JH3-H is set to 1 while other devices are
communicating, the start condition may be detected depending on the status of the communication line. Be sure to
set the IICCn.IICEn bit to 1 when the SCL0n and SDA0n lines are high level.
(4) Determine the operation clock frequency by using the IICCLn, IICXn, and OCKSm registers before enabling the
operation (IICCn.IICEn bit = 1). To change the operation clock frequency, first clear the IICCn.IICEn bit to 0.
(5) After the IICCn.STTn and IICCn.SPTn bits have been set to 1, they must not be re-set without being cleared to 0
first.
(6) If transmission has been reserved, set the IICCN.SPIEn bit to 1 so that an interrupt request is generated by the
detection of a stop condition. After an interrupt request has been generated, the wait status will be released by
writing communication data to I
2
Cn, then transfer will begin. If an interrupt is not generated by the detection of a
stop condition, transmission will halt in the wait status because an interrupt request was not generated. However, it
is not necessary to set the SPIEn bit to 1 for the software to detect the IICSn.MSTSn bit.
Remark n = 0 to 2
m = 0, 1
